OKLAHOMA CITY -- Oklahoma Sooners head coach Bob Stoops denied the rumors that he would be interested in leaving Oklahoma for a possible coaching position at Notre Dame.
”That’s ridiculous. Some confidant? I have no idea what you’re talking about,” Stoops said at media availability Monday. “Notre Dame doesn’t have a job right now. That’s just some guy making something up. That’s ridiculous.”
With Fighting Irish head coach Charlie Weis on the hot seat, rumors emerged early Monday that Stoops would be in the mix for the top spot at Notre Dame.
